China increases focus on managed business travel: study
Posted by in Business Travel NewsSharing the results of 2007 China Business Travel Survey (The Barometer), conducted by Research International from May to August 2007, interviewing 230 Chinese and foreign companies with 100 and more employees in six key industries in Shanghai, Beijing and Guangzhou, the company stated that the China business travel market is also maturing with increased focus on Travel & Entertainment (T&E) …
